Hvad er Ethereum Name Service (ENS)?
Hjem
Artikler
Hvad er Ethereum Name Service (ENS)?

Hvad er Ethereum Name Service (ENS)?

Begynder
Offentliggjort Nov 25, 2021Opdateret Nov 11, 2022
6m

TL;DR

Ethereum Name Service (ENS) er en navngivningstjeneste til tegnebogsadresser, hashes og andre maskinlæsbare identifikatorer. Det bliver vanskeligt at læse datastrenge til letlæselige adresser. Det fungerer på samme måde som med Domain Name System (DNS), der bruges til websteder.

Oprindeligt auktionerede ENS populære domænenavne på seks, fem, fire og tre bogstaver til interesserede brugere ved hjælp af Vickrey-auktionsformatet. Hvert navn har .eth i slutningen og kan knyttes til flere kryptovalutaadresser, hashes og andre oplysninger.

Du kan nu nemt købe navne uden en auktion og leje dem per år. Priserne afhænger af længden af det navn, du vil leje. Hvis du ejede et ENS-domæne den 31. oktober 2021, har du også ret til en airdrop af $ENS-styringstokens. Du har indtil d. 4. maj 2022 til at afhente dem.


Introduktion

En af blockchains største udfordringer er at forbedre dens brugervenlighed og tilgængelighed. Hvis vi ser på betalinger ved hjælp af ethereum (ETH) eller bitcoin (BTC), kan nye og sågar erfarne brugere opleve lange tegnebogsadresser som upraktiske og forvirrende. Hexadecimale talrækker er enkle for en computer at læse, men mindre intuitive for menneskelige brugere. Ethereum Name Service (ENS) bekæmper problemet ved at give alle mulighed for at oprette enkle adresser, der ligner webaddresser, og som er lettere at huske og bruge.


Hvad er Ethereum Name Service?

Ethereum Name Service (ENS) er et ethereum-baseret projekt, der blev lanceret den 4. maj 2017 af Alex Van de Sande og Nick Johnson fra Ethereum Foundation. Projektet giver brugerne mulighed for at vise lange, offentlige ethereum-adresser på en forenklet tekstbaseret måde. Dette gør det nemmere at dele, bruge og huske adresser og andre data. At omdanne maskinlæsbare tal som 0xAb5801a7D398351b8bE11C439e05C5B3259aeC9B til menneskeligt læsbare alternativer er en vigtig del af forbedringen af blockchain-vedtagelsen.

ENS er heller ikke kun begrænset til tegnebogsadresser. Den kan bruges til at repræsentere transaktions-id'er, hashes og metadata, som alle findes i kryptovalutaverdenen. Du er måske allerede bekendt med Domain Name System (DNS), som er et navngivningssystem, der fungerer som internettets telefonbog. DNS tager IP-adresser, der er svære at huske, og knytter dem til en brugervenlig URL som https://academy.binance.com. I virkeligheden er ENS et DNS for ethereum-blockchainen.

ENS har siden lanceret et styringstoken som en del af overgangen til en decentraliseret autonom organisation (DAO). På grund af en stor stigning i tokenets pris er projektets popularitet begyndt at stige og generere stor interesse.


Hvordan fungerer ethereum-mining?

Et ENS-domænenavn bruge det ikke-ombyttelige token ERC-721 (NFT) til at repræsentere en unik adresse. Du kan handle med et domæne ved at overføre eller sælge et NFT til en anden. Tegnebogsadresser og andre oplysninger er knyttet til hvert token, som kan administreres af ejeren. Et topdomæne som .eth ejes af en intelligent kontrakt kaldet en registrator, der kontrollerer oprettelsen af underdomæner. Hvis du vil oprette BinanceAcademy.eth, skal du interagere med .eth-registratoren.

For at købe et ethereum-domænenavn kan du kontrollere dets tilgængelighed og leje det på årlig basis. Populære navne blev dog i første omgang bortauktioneret. Den højestbydende, der vandt domænet, kunne derefter vedhæfte adresser, oprette underdomæner og låne eller sælge deres domænenavn. For eksempel, hvis du ejede BinanceAcademy.eth, ville du også kunne oprette learn.BinanceAcademy.eth gratis.


Hvad kan du gøre med ENS?

Hvis du nogensinde har forvekslet flere adresser med hinanden, når du sender kryptovalutaer, forstår du behovet for ENS. Ligesom du ville gemme en vens telefonnummer under deres navn, giver ENS brugerne mulighed for at omdanne lange tal til ord, der er nemme at huske. Dette skaber en mere ligetil oplevelse med mindre risici for fejl.

En ENS-domæneejer kan også oprette underdomæner, som de derefter kan tildele andre data til. Det behøver heller ikke altid at være en tegnebogsadresse. Du kan bruge det til at dirigere til en intelligent kontrakt, transaktion eller metadata.


Hvordan får du dit eget ENS-domæne?

I dag er det så simpelt at få et ENS-navn som at kontrollere dets tilgængelighed på https://app.ens.domains/ og registrere det. Lad os se et eksempel på, hvordan du starter processen. Først skal du gå til https://app.ens.domains/, så skal du tilslutte din tegnebog, og derefter indtaste det domæne, du er interesseret i.


Du kan nu se tilgængeligheden af dit valgte navn. I vores tilfælde kan BinanceAcademy registreres.


Når du klikker på navnet, vil du se instruktioner om registrering af ENS-domænet. Du kan vælge din registreringsperiode og også se et skøn over gebyrerne. Med ether (ETH) i din tegnebog kan du følge de tre viste trin og anmode om at registrere adressen.


I de tidlige ENS-dage blev populære navne på seks, fem, fire og tre bogstaver bortauktioneret på auktioner, der minder om Vickrey. En intelligent kontrakt kørte hele processen over fem dage. Enhver kunne deltage i en offentlig auktion og forsøge at købe det samme domænenavn. Hver interesseret part sender en transaktion med deres maksimale bud i den åbne auktions første tre dage.

Auktionen gik derefter ind i afsløringsfasen. Alle ville afsløre deres bud eller miste deres låste ETH, og vedkommende bag det vindende bud skulle betale et beløb svarende til det næststørste bud. Alle afslørede bud ville derefter modtage en refusion.


Hvor meget koster det at få et ENS-domæne?

Der er to mulige dele ved omkostningerne for et ENS-domæne: auktionsomkostninger og lejeomkostninger. Prisen på et ENS-domænenavn på en auktion var afhængig af navnets popularitet. Genkendelige navne som Gud, Bil eller ETH hentede højere priser, og korte ord på tre bogstaver var typisk de dyreste. Nedenfor kan du se eksempler på nogle af de priser, der betales for domænenavne.


Når du ejer et ENS-domæne, skal du betale en årlig fornyelsesomkostning, der skal betales i ETH. Gebyrer betegnes i dollars, men konverteres ved hjælp af en valutakurs givet af ETH/USD-oraklet Chainlink. De årlige fornyelsesomkostninger er 5 USD om året for navne med fem tegn eller mere, men bliver dyrere, jo færre bogstaver du har.


Hvordan indløser man et Ethereum Name Service-airdrop?

Alle, som har et skærmbillede af  .eth-adressen den 31. oktober 2021, er berettigede til at modtage $ENS-tokens. Du kan indløse dem med et par enkle trin. Du har indtil d. 4. maj 2022 til at indløse dine tokens, før de bliver brændt.

1. Gå først til ENS Airdrop og tilslut din tegnebog med knappen [Connect] eller [Connect wallet].


2. Vælg den tegnebog, du vil oprette forbindelse til, såsom MetaMask, WalletConnect eller en anden udbyder.


3. Klik på [Get Started] for at fortsætte.


4. Du får nu mulighed for at vælge [Start your claim process] sammen med det beløb, du er berettiget til at modtage.

5. Sørg for at læse de informative oplysninger om $ENS, efterfulgt af forfatningen, som du skal underskrive ved hjælp af din tegnebog.

6. Nu kan du vælge at delegere dine tokens til dig selv eller en anden bruger.

7. Til sidst skal du kontrollere det beløb, du gør krav på, og din delegerede, før du klikker på [Claim] og betaler et gasgebyr for at få adgang til dine tokens.


Sammenfatning

I en verden af decentraliserede netværk er ENS et skridt fremad for at skabe let tilgængelige måder at interagere med en blockchain på. Ligesom vi ikke længere bruger IP-adresser til at navigere på nettet, kan vi se en stigning i ENS-navne på grund af dets anvendelighed og stigende popularitet. Siden lanceringen har der også været en stigning i interessen fra kryptovalutaøkosystemet i projektet.